# SPDX-License-Identifier: Apache-2.0
"""Tests for LMCacheTimeoutError (observability-aware timeout error).
Verifies that the class is a drop-in ``TimeoutError`` subclass, is a no-op
when observability is disabled, and otherwise publishes a ``TIMEOUT_RAISED``
event to the global EventBus carrying the message, exception type, and a
captured stack trace.
"""
# Standard
import time
# Third Party
import pytest
# First Party
from lmcache.v1.mp_observability.errors import LMCacheTimeoutError
from lmcache.v1.mp_observability.event import Event, EventType
from lmcache.v1.mp_observability.event_bus import (
EventBusConfig,
init_event_bus,
)
# Time for the drain thread to process queued events.
_DRAIN_WAIT = 0.15
@pytest.fixture(autouse=True)
def _restore_global_bus():
"""Reset the global EventBus to the disabled default after each test."""
yield
init_event_bus(EventBusConfig(enabled=False))
class TestLMCacheTimeoutErrorType:
def test_is_timeout_error_subclass(self) -> None:
assert issubclass(LMCacheTimeoutError, TimeoutError)
def test_caught_by_except_timeout_error(self) -> None:
init_event_bus(EventBusConfig(enabled=False))
with pytest.raises(TimeoutError):
raise LMCacheTimeoutError("boom")
def test_message_preserved(self) -> None:
init_event_bus(EventBusConfig(enabled=False))
err = LMCacheTimeoutError("the message")
assert str(err) == "the message"
class TestLMCacheTimeoutErrorEmission:
def test_no_event_when_observability_disabled(self) -> None:
bus = init_event_bus(EventBusConfig(enabled=False))
captured: list[Event] = []
bus.subscribe(EventType.TIMEOUT_RAISED, captured.append)
bus.start() # no-op when disabled
LMCacheTimeoutError("nope")
time.sleep(_DRAIN_WAIT)
bus.stop()
assert captured == []
def test_publishes_event_when_enabled(self) -> None:
bus = init_event_bus(EventBusConfig(enabled=True, max_queue_size=100))
captured: list[Event] = []
bus.subscribe(EventType.TIMEOUT_RAISED, captured.append)
bus.start()
LMCacheTimeoutError("timed out!", session_id="req-7")
time.sleep(_DRAIN_WAIT)
bus.stop()
assert len(captured) == 1
event = captured[0]
assert event.event_type == EventType.TIMEOUT_RAISED
assert event.session_id == "req-7"
assert event.metadata["message"] == "timed out!"
assert event.metadata["exception_type"] == "LMCacheTimeoutError"
# The construction stack should be captured and include the caller.
assert "test_publishes_event_when_enabled" in event.metadata["stacktrace"]
def test_subclass_reports_its_own_type(self) -> None:
class MyTimeout(LMCacheTimeoutError):
pass
bus = init_event_bus(EventBusConfig(enabled=True, max_queue_size=100))
captured: list[Event] = []
bus.subscribe(EventType.TIMEOUT_RAISED, captured.append)
bus.start()
MyTimeout("sub")
time.sleep(_DRAIN_WAIT)
bus.stop()
assert len(captured) == 1
assert captured[0].metadata["exception_type"] == "MyTimeout"
